ANDROID APPLICATION
DEVELOPMENT CON JAVA
ANDROID APLICATION DEVELOPMENT CON JAVA
Lesson 1: Android Framework and Android Studio
Introduction
Android Software Layers
Android Libraries
Components of an Android Application
ApplicationLife-cycle
Pre-requisitesfor Android ApplicationDevelopment
Android Studio
Gradle
Lab 1: CreatingYourFirstApplication
Lesson 2: Android SDK Tools and ActivityClass
Android Project Structure
The Android Manifest File
Structure of theManifest File
Android SDK Tools
Activity
Methods to Remember
Lab 2: Controlling a Camera’s Flash Light
Lesson 3: Fragments, Views, and List View
Introduction
Fragments
Views
ListViews and ListActivity
Methods to remember
Lab 3: Creating a Simple To-Do ListApplication
Lesson 4: Intents and Intentfilters
Introduction
Intents
Native Android Actions
Data Transfer
Intent toCallActivities
RegisteranIntentFilter
Methods to remember
Lab 4: CreatingContactsSelectionApplication
Lesson 5: Android Layouts and CustomViews
Introduction
Views
Layouts
CustomizedViews
ModifyExistingViews
Lab 5: Custom View, DrawerLayout, and FragmentsApplication
Lesson 6: Android Resources, Themes, and Material Design
Introduction
Android Resources
Android Themes and Styles
Android Material Design
Methods to remember
Lab 6: A To-Do ListApplication in Material Design
VII
Lesson 7: Android UI – Dialogs, Menus, and WebView
Introduction
UserInteractionthroughMessages
Dialogs
ActivitieswithDialogTheme
Toasts
Menus
ContextMenus
AdditionalMenuItemOptions
PopupMenus
Web View
Methods to Remember
Lab 7: WallpaperApplication
Lesson 8: Android Storage and BackgroundProcessing
Android Storage Options
File I/O
SharedPreferences
Connecting to the internet
BackgroundProcessing
Lab 8: QuotesProviderApplication
Lesson 9: Android Storage: SQLite and Content Providers
Introduction
Databases in Android
Content Providers
Native Android Content Providers
Custom Content Provider
SyncAdapters
Methods to Remember
Lab 9: SQLiteDatabases and Content Providers
Lesson 10: Android Notifications
Introduction
Creating a notification
Notificationactions
ExpandableNotifications
NotificationsLayouts
NotificationPriority
Notifications in Android 5.0 (Lollipop)
Lab 10: Implementing Android Notifications
Duración: 4 meses
Certificado: Oficial de ATC
Inicio: 14 de Agosto
Inversión: Bs. 3150.- ( Tres mil ciento cincuenta 00/100 Bolivianos)
Informaciones:
Correo electrónico: [email protected]
Facebook: cisco.lapazótekhne.lp
Teléfono: 2 2971993
Cel/Whatsapp: 77505099
Av. 20 de Octubre esq. Campos, "Torre Azul" Piso 5 Of.5b
La Paz - Bolivia